The TRADEMARKSCAN® - U.S. FEDERAL database, produced by Thomson CompuMark, provides information on all active registered trademarks, service marks, and applications for registration filed at the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O). Pending applications include both actual-use and intent-to-use applications. International registrations under Madrid Protocol are included from November 2, 2003 forward. The database serves principally as a preliminary fast screening tool for checking the availability of new product or service names. A search on the TRADEMARKSCAN - U.S. FEDERAL database should not be used as the sole basis for clearing a new name or for filing a trademark application. If a trademark is not found in the database, it does not necessarily mean that the trademark is available for use. In the U.S., trademark rights are conferred by use or by filing an intent-to-use trademark application, and it is not necessary to register a trademark. Registration does, however, offer a greater degree of protection from infringement. Before a mark is adopted, additional searching is recommended, especially for common law usage, i.e., marks in use but not registered anywhere. Inactive federal registrations (again, the mark itself may still be in use) and state registrations (File 246, TRADEMARKSCAN® - U.S. STATE) should also be searched.
Each record contains the trademark, international class numbers, the owner's name, a description of the goods or services, the USPTO serial number and complete information about the status of the mark as supplied by the USPTO. Many records have additional information and historical data, such as changes in ownership and actions brought before the Trademark Trial and Appeals Board. Registered or pending marks that changed to inactive status since 1984 (i.e., expired, cancelled, or abandoned) remain in the database with the most current status indicated. Trademarks can be searched as phrases (ET=), as whole words or word beginnings in the Basic Index, or as word fragments or word endings in the rotated index TR=. Marks consisting of corrupted spellings, unconventional presentations of words, non-Latin characters, or non-English-language words have been enhanced with cross references to facilitate retrieval.
Records for Design Only marks and those that have a design element, including block and stylized lettering, include images. Trademark designs and logos are referenced in appropriate fields, e.g., Design Type (DT=), Lining/Color Claims (PH=), and Design Phrase (PH=).

1 Use the Basic Index to search complete words, compound words, or word beginnings, e.g., S KEY?. Use the rotated index TR= to search word fragments, or word endings, e.g., TR=MAIL?. Since punctuation is stripped for trademark searching, use the AND operator instead of the (W) operator for the most comprehensive retrieval. Compound words should be searched as the whole word and as its parts, e.g., S KEYMAIL? OR (KEY AND MAIL?).
2 Trademarks and owner names longer than 32 characters are truncated in REPORT displays.
3 Trademarks consisting of corrupted spellings, unconventional presentations of words, non-Latin characters, or non-English language words are enhanced with cross references to facilitate retrieval. Most enhancements (cross-references) to trademarks are not displayed in the record.
